Quinnipiac University is in Hamden, CT.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 7 software engineering degrees were granted at Quinnipiac University.

Studying Online at Quinnipiac University

Online coursework is an option at Quinnipiac University. Among 9,424 students, 984 (10%) studied exclusively online and 3,168 (34%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Take a look at the composition of Software Engineering graduates at Quinnipiac University, broken down by degree level.

Looking at the program as a whole, Software Engineering graduates at Quinnipiac University are 43% women (3) and 57% men (4).

Software Engineering Bachelor’s Program at Quinnipiac University

Of the 7 bachelor’s software engineering graduates at Quinnipiac University, 43% were women (3) and 57% were men (4).

Quinnipiac University gender breakdown of Software Engineering Bachelor's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Software Engineering bachelor’s degree recipients at Quinnipiac University.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 2
Hispanic / Latino 1
Black / African American 1
Asian 1
Two or More Races 2
Racial-ethnic diversity of Software Engineering majors at Quinnipiac University

Racial-ethnic minorities make up 71% of Software Engineering bachelor’s degree recipients at Quinnipiac University, higher than the national average of 38%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
